
Chicken Lettuce Wraps
The restaurant favorite — a savory-sweet skillet of chopped chicken, mushrooms, and ginger spooned into crisp, cupped lettuce leaves at the table.
Ingredients
serves 4From the garden
- 1 head butter or iceberg lettuce, leaves separated, kept whole as cups
- 4 green onions, sliced, whites and greens separated
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
From the pantry
- 1 lb boneless chicken thighs, finely chopped — or ground chicken
- 8 oz mushrooms, finely diced
- 1 tbsp fresh ginger, grated
- 3 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tbsp honey
- 1 tbsp rice vinegar
- 1 tsp cornstarch
- 2 tsp toasted sesame oil
- 1 tbsp vegetable oil
- hot sauce (optional) — for serving
Steps
tap a step to dim it as you go- Stir together the sauce: soy sauce, honey, rice vinegar, cornstarch, and sesame oil. Rinse the lettuce cups, pat dry, and chill until serving — cold, crisp leaves are half the dish.
- Heat the vegetable oil in a wide skillet over high heat. Add the chopped chicken and cook, breaking it up, 4–5 minutes until browned in spots and cooked through to 165°F.
- Add the mushrooms and cook 3–4 minutes until their moisture evaporates and they start to brown — the mixture should look dry, not soupy.
- Add the green onion whites, garlic, and ginger and stir 30 seconds, then pour in the sauce and toss until it bubbles and glazes the chicken, about 1 minute.
- Pile the filling into a bowl, top with the green onion tops, and serve with the lettuce cups for wrapping at the table, hot sauce alongside.
